Output efa41d3405c426b336db93f2d163e6d7208564257c346fc80bac1354a8e7abde:3

value
852014893
script pubkey
OP_0 OP_PUSHBYTES_20 ecb3dbcac6ccea365b5fef80e4969050fdf9ae16
address
bc1qajeahjkxen4rvk6la7qwf95s2r7lntskfftdg4
transaction
efa41d3405c426b336db93f2d163e6d7208564257c346fc80bac1354a8e7abde
confirmations
129249
spent
true